Romano Giannetti submitted an update to the
CircuiTikZ
package.
Version: 1.3.3 2021-04-04 License: lppl gpl
Summary description: Draw electrical networks with TikZ
Announcement text: ----------------------------------------------------------------------
Several usability additions in this version, and one small fix that could change the look of your circuit (without affecting correctness). Some of the arrow shapes are now configurable.
- Added options to fine-tune the position of labels and annotations
- Added options to change arrow tips on variable resistors, inductors and capacitors as well as in potentiometers
- Added options to change arrow tips on switches
- Added anchors to inductance to add core lines
- Fixed the default direction of tunable arrows (with an option to go back to the old ones)
